The only thing that would make this better is some color. Idk y others dont like this, but I LOVE it! It's very similar to the 2 Dots Scavenger Hunt & Hidden Through Time games, but there's more to it. There are silly sounds, but I think they're fun & you can turn them down. My favorite is that I can interact with some objects, & this helps you find some items. It's more interactive with the player & I love that. It's a little closer to a puzzle than just a picture hunt. & can get difficult!
